/*!
\file op_code.hpp
Defines the OpCode enum type and functions related to it.
*/
/*!
Type used to distinguish different AD< \a Base > atomic operations.
Each of the operators ends with the characters Op. Ignoring the Op at the end,
the operators appear in alphabetical order. Binary operation where both
operands have type AD< \a Base > use the following convention for thier endings:
\verbatim
Ending Left-Operand Right-Operand
pvOp parameter variable
vpOp variable parameter
vvOp variable variable
\endverbatim
For example, AddpvOp represents the addition operator where the left
operand is a parameter and the right operand is a variable.
*/
// alphabetical order is checked by bin/check_op_code.sh
enum OpCode {
AbsOp, // fabs(variable)
AcosOp, // acos(variable)
AcoshOp, // acosh(variable)
AddpvOp, // parameter + variable
AddvvOp, // variable + variable
AsinOp, // asin(variable)
AsinhOp, // asinh(variable)
AtanOp, // atan(variable)
AtanhOp, // atanh(variable)
BeginOp, // used to mark the beginning of the tape
CExpOp, // CondExpRel(left, right, trueCase, falseCase)
// arg[0] = the Rel operator: Lt, Le, Eq, Ge, Gt, or Ne
// arg[1] & 1 = is left a variable
// arg[1] & 2 = is right a variable
// arg[1] & 4 = is trueCase a variable
// arg[1] & 8 = is falseCase a variable
// arg[2] = index correspoding to left
// arg[3] = index correspoding to right
// arg[4] = index correspoding to trueCase
// arg[5] = index correspoding to falseCase
CosOp, // cos(variable)
CoshOp, // cosh(variable)
CSkipOp, // Conditional skip
// arg[0] = the Rel operator: Lt, Le, Eq, Ge, Gt, or Ne
// arg[1] & 1 = is left a variable
// arg[1] & 2 = is right a variable
// arg[2] = index correspoding to left
// arg[3] = index correspoding to right
// arg[4] = number of operations to skip if CExpOp comparision is true
// arg[5] = number of operations to skip if CExpOp comparision is false
// arg[6] -> arg[5+arg[4]] = skip operations if true
// arg[6+arg[4]] -> arg[5+arg[4]+arg[5]] = skip operations if false
// arg[6+arg[4]+arg[5]] = arg[4] + arg[5]
CSumOp, // Cummulative summation
// arg[0] = number of addition variables in summation
// arg[1] = number of subtraction variables in summation
// arg[2] = index of parameter that initializes summation
// arg[3] -> arg[2+arg[0]] = index for positive variables
// arg[3+arg[0]] -> arg[2+arg[0]+arg[1]] = index for minus variables
// arg[3+arg[0]+arg[1]] = arg[0] + arg[1]
DisOp, // discrete::eval(index, variable)
DivpvOp, // parameter / variable
DivvpOp, // variable / parameter
DivvvOp, // variable / variable
EndOp, // used to mark the end of the tape
EqpvOp, // parameter == variable
EqvvOp, // variable == variable
ErfOp, // erf(variable)
ExpOp, // exp(variable)
Expm1Op, // expm1(variable)
InvOp, // independent variable
LdpOp, // z[parameter]
LdvOp, // z[variable]
LepvOp, // parameter <= variable
LevpOp, // variable <= parameter
LevvOp, // variable <= variable
LogOp, // log(variable)
Log1pOp, // log1p(variable)
LtpvOp, // parameter < variable
LtvpOp, // variable < parameter
LtvvOp, // variable < variable
MulpvOp, // parameter * variable
MulvvOp, // variable * variable
NepvOp, // parameter != variable
NevvOp, // variable != variable
ParOp, // parameter
PowpvOp, // pow(parameter, variable)
PowvpOp, // pow(variable, parameter)
PowvvOp, // pow(variable, variable)
PriOp, // PrintFor(text, parameter or variable, parameter or variable)
SignOp, // sign(variable)
SinOp, // sin(variable)
SinhOp, // sinh(variable)
SqrtOp, // sqrt(variable)
StppOp, // z[parameter] = parameter
StpvOp, // z[parameter] = variable
StvpOp, // z[variable] = parameter
StvvOp, // z[variable] = variable
SubpvOp, // parameter - variable
SubvpOp, // variable - parameter
SubvvOp, // variable - variable
TanOp, // tan(variable)
TanhOp, // tan(variable)
// user atomic operation codes
UserOp, // start of a user atomic operaiton
// arg[0] = index of the operation if atomic_base<Base> class
// arg[1] = extra information passed trough by deprecated old atomic class
// arg[2] = number of arguments to this atomic function
// arg[3] = number of results for this atomic function
UsrapOp, // this user atomic argument is a parameter
UsravOp, // this user atomic argument is a variable
UsrrpOp, // this user atomic result is a parameter
UsrrvOp, // this user atomic result is a variable
ZmulpvOp, // azmul(parameter, variable)
ZmulvpOp, // azmul(variabe, parameter)
ZmulvvOp, // azmul(variable, variable)
NumberOp // number of operator codes (not an operator)
};

/*!
Number of arguments for a specified operator.
\return
Number of arguments corresponding to the specified operator.
\param op
Operator for which we are fetching the number of arugments.
\par NumArgTable
this table specifes the number of arguments stored for each
occurance of the operator that is the i-th value in the OpCode enum type.
For example, for the first three OpCode enum values we have
\verbatim
OpCode j NumArgTable[j] Meaning
AbsOp 0 1 index of variable we are taking absolute value of
AcosOp 1 1 index of variable we are taking acos of
AcoshOp 2 1 index of variable we are taking acosh of
\endverbatim
Note that the meaning of the arguments depends on the operator.
*/
inline size_t NumArg( OpCode op)
{ CPPAD_ASSERT_FIRST_CALL_NOT_PARALLEL;
// agreement with OpCode is checked by bin/check_op_code.sh
static const size_t NumArgTable[] = {
1, // AbsOp
1, // AcosOp
1, // AcoshOp
2, // AddpvOp
2, // AddvvOp
1, // AsinOp
1, // AsinhOp
1, // AtanOp
1, // AtanhOp
1, // BeginOp offset first real argument to have index 1
6, // CExpOp
1, // CosOp
1, // CoshOp
0, // CSkipOp (actually has a variable number of arguments, not zero)
0, // CSumOp (actually has a variable number of arguments, not zero)
2, // DisOp
2, // DivpvOp
2, // DivvpOp
2, // DivvvOp
0, // EndOp
2, // EqpvOp
2, // EqvvOp
3, // ErfOp
1, // ExpOp
1, // Expm1Op
0, // InvOp
3, // LdpOp
3, // LdvOp
2, // LepvOp
2, // LevpOp
2, // LevvOp
1, // LogOp
1, // Log1pOp
2, // LtpvOp
2, // LtvpOp
2, // LtvvOp
2, // MulpvOp
2, // MulvvOp
2, // NepvOp
2, // NevvOp
1, // ParOp
2, // PowpvOp
2, // PowvpOp
2, // PowvvOp
5, // PriOp
1, // SignOp
1, // SinOp
1, // SinhOp
1, // SqrtOp
3, // StppOp
3, // StpvOp
3, // StvpOp
3, // StvvOp
2, // SubpvOp
2, // SubvpOp
2, // SubvvOp
1, // TanOp
1, // TanhOp
4, // UserOp
1, // UsrapOp
1, // UsravOp
1, // UsrrpOp
0, // UsrrvOp
2, // ZmulpvOp
2, // ZmulvpOp
2, // ZmulvvOp
0 // NumberOp not used
};
# ifndef NDEBUG
// only do these checks once to save time
static bool first = true;
if( first )
{ CPPAD_ASSERT_UNKNOWN( size_t(NumberOp) + 1 ==
sizeof(NumArgTable) / sizeof(NumArgTable[0])
);
CPPAD_ASSERT_UNKNOWN( size_t(NumberOp) <=
std::numeric_limits<CPPAD_OP_CODE_TYPE>::max()
);
first = false;
}
// do this check every time
CPPAD_ASSERT_UNKNOWN( size_t(op) < size_t(NumberOp) );
# endif
return NumArgTable[op];
}

/*!
Prints a single field corresponding to an operator.
A specified leader is printed in front of the value
and then the value is left justified in the following width character.
\tparam Type
is the type of the value we are printing.
\param os
is the stream that we are printing to.
\param leader
are characters printed before the value.
\param value
is the value being printed.
\param width
is the number of character to print the value in.
If the value does not fit in the width, the value is replace
by width '*' characters.
*/
template <class Type>
void printOpField(
std::ostream &os ,
const char * leader ,
const Type &value ,
size_t width )
{
std::ostringstream buffer;
std::string str;
// first print the leader
os << leader;
// print the value into an internal buffer
buffer << std::setw(width) << value;
str = buffer.str();
// length of the string
size_t len = str.size();
if( len > width )
{ size_t i;
for(i = 0; i < width-1; i++)
os << str[i];
os << "*";
return;
}
// count number of spaces at begining
size_t nspace = 0;
while(str[nspace] == ' ' && nspace < len)
nspace++;
// left justify the string
size_t i = nspace;
while( i < len )
os << str[i++];
i = width - len + nspace;
while(i--)
os << " ";
}
